ORDER Directing Clerk to Make Service. The court directs the Federal Respondents to file an answer or dispositive motion in response to the claims in the Petition within seven days of the date of this Order. In their response, the Federal Respondents are directed to show cause why the Court should not issue an order granting the Petition to the extent of ordering Respondents to afford Petitioner a bond hearing within seven days of that orders issuance, based on Petitioner's claimed membership in the Guerrero Orellana class and similarity to the petitioner in Destino. Respondents shall provide this Court with at least seventy-two hours of advance notice of any scheduled removal or transfer of Petitioner out of this Court's jurisdiction. So Ordered by US Magistrate Judge Talesha L. Saint-Marc.(de) (Entered: 05/22/2026)
